REVIEWER
SETTING
A literary element of literature used in novels, short stories, plays, films, etc., and usually introduces the when and where of the story during the exposition (beginning).
DIALOGUE
An interchange of conversation of the characters whether in a movie or a play
FORESHADOWING
It is where the author suggests future events in a story, or outcome, before they happen or take place.
A literary device in which a writer gives an advance hint of what is to come later in the story.
RISING ACTION
This is when the main character is in crisis and the conflict begins to unfold.
1ST PERSON POINT OF VIEW
A type of Point of View (POV) that is usually identifiable using the pronoun "I".
PROTAGONIST
The main character, who creates the action of the plot and is often a hero or heroine of the story
PERSONIFICATION
When inanimate objects or abstract concepts are given or provided with human self-awareness or characteristics.

ALLITERATION
The repetition of consonant sounds in succeeding words within the same sentence or line.
HYPERBOLE
An exaggerated description of an idea or action
METAPHOR
Applying a direct relationship to an object or idea as a substitute for another.
OXYMORON
An idea of contradicting terms
PARALLELISM
It is the use of identical language, events, structures, or ideas in different parts of a text.
SYMBOLISM
It's when objects or images are used to represent abstract ideas. It could be something tangible or visible, while the idea it's trying to symbolize is something abstract or universal.
IRONY
An absurd or mocking opposition to what is expected or appropriate.
TRANSLATION
It is the process of translating words or text from one language to another.
TEXTUALITY
This refers to all attributes that distinguish the communicative content under analysis as an object of study
PARODY
It is usually a small excerpt of a hypotext that assists in the understanding of the new hypertext's original themes, characters or contexts
Julia Kristeva
originated the theory of intertextuality
Latent Intertextuality
It pertains to everything you've ever seen or read that sticks somewhere in your memory and affects your understanding of the world.
INTERTEXTUALITY
It is the author's borrowing and transformation of a prior text or to a reader's referencing of one text in reading another.
PASTICHE
It imitates the style or character of the work of one or more other artists.
QUOTATION
A written form of the oral echo. It can be in tagged or untagged form.
CALQUE
It means to borrow a word or phrase from another language while translating it components so as to create a new lexeme.
CONNOTATION
refers to the additional meaning or emotion that a word cames beyond its literal definition. It includes the associations, feelings, or implications that people may have about a word based on their cultural, social, or personal experiences
